Da ich seit gestern im TB bereits PHP 8.4 nutze, eine weitere Erkenntnis am Rande:
Ich habe festgestellt, dass 8.4 bei der Performance zugelegt hat. Gemerkt habe ich das beim Cache Aufbau, der braucht bei mir im lokalen 3.3 TB normalerweise über 3 Sekunden, jetzt in knapp der Hälfte. Auch EMP baut die ExtMgr Seite schneller auf, aber da ist es nicht so deutlich. Und das gilt durch die Bank; entweder es ist spürbar schneller, oder wenigstens messbar.
Davon profitieren gerade lokale Windows Installationen wie Wampserver, XAMPP usw. Für mich als Entwickler ist vor allem der schnellere Cache Aufbau interessant, da ich ja quasi ständig den Cache löschen muss.
Buschtrommel: PHP 8.4 und relevante Änderungen
Re: Buschtrommel: PHP 8.4 und relevante Änderungen
Möge das Backup mit dir sein. Immer.
Kein Support via PN! Siehe den Punkt "Private Nachrichten" im phpBB.de-Knigge.
Erweiterungen - Infos zur artgerechten Haltung / phpBB Ext Check - Analyse von Erweiterungen bezüglich Vorgaben und Kompatibilität
Kein Support via PN! Siehe den Punkt "Private Nachrichten" im phpBB.de-Knigge.
Erweiterungen - Infos zur artgerechten Haltung / phpBB Ext Check - Analyse von Erweiterungen bezüglich Vorgaben und Kompatibilität
Re: Buschtrommel: PHP 8.4 und relevante Änderungen
Was die Sache mit
implicit nullable
angeht, ist mir bei einer meiner EXT aufgefallen das es keinerlei Fehlermeldungen unter PHP 8.4 diesbezüglich gibt, obwohl es eigentlich eine geben müsste. Das lässt vermuten das phpBB diese Meldungen effektiv unterdrückt, auch im Debug Modus. Der phpBB Ext Check meldet dies zumindestens.Re: Buschtrommel: PHP 8.4 und relevante Änderungen
Jupp, habe ich kurz nach Release von 8.4 auch schon festgestellt, aber vergessen hier zu kommentieren. Ich zitiere hier 2 Nachrichten von mir von Discord:
LukeWCS — 23.11.2024 19:28
Okay, jetzt ist es klar, phpBB unterdrückt das komplett. Was es aber zumindest im Debug Modus nicht sollte.
LukeWCS — 24.11.2024 12:06
...Aber der Punkt ist, dass selbst da keine Einträge geloggt werden, weil DEPRECATED von phpBB komplett unterdrückt wird, also auch PHP Log. Erst wenn man das im Core ändert, kriegt man diese Meldungen.
Möge das Backup mit dir sein. Immer.
Kein Support via PN! Siehe den Punkt "Private Nachrichten" im phpBB.de-Knigge.
Erweiterungen - Infos zur artgerechten Haltung / phpBB Ext Check - Analyse von Erweiterungen bezüglich Vorgaben und Kompatibilität
Kein Support via PN! Siehe den Punkt "Private Nachrichten" im phpBB.de-Knigge.
Erweiterungen - Infos zur artgerechten Haltung / phpBB Ext Check - Analyse von Erweiterungen bezüglich Vorgaben und Kompatibilität
Re: Buschtrommel: PHP 8.4 und relevante Änderungen
Nachdem ich nun (mit anderen) über das heutige Discord Update gemeckert habe, muss ich weiter meckern und zwar in meine eigene Richtung und zu einem ganz anderen Thema.
Ich dachte ich hätte längst folgende Falschaussage richtiggestellt:
Nach Umstellung auf 8.4 im November, fiel mir irgendwann unter Wampserver auf, das meine Debug Anzeigen nicht mehr die übliche Struktur und Infos hatten. Nach einige Suche bemerkte ich, dass das xDebug Modul gar nicht mehr aktiv war. Die Version die ich hatte, war schlicht nicht 8.4-kompatibel. Nachdem ich das aktualisiert und wieder aktiviert hatte, wars sofort vorbei mit der schönen Performance-Steigerung.
Ich dachte ich hätte längst folgende Falschaussage richtiggestellt:
Aber das habe ich wohl aus lauter Scham erfolgreich verdrängt gehabt.LukeWCS hat geschrieben: 23.11.2024 13:31 Ich habe festgestellt, dass 8.4 bei der Performance zugelegt hat.

Möge das Backup mit dir sein. Immer.
Kein Support via PN! Siehe den Punkt "Private Nachrichten" im phpBB.de-Knigge.
Erweiterungen - Infos zur artgerechten Haltung / phpBB Ext Check - Analyse von Erweiterungen bezüglich Vorgaben und Kompatibilität
Kein Support via PN! Siehe den Punkt "Private Nachrichten" im phpBB.de-Knigge.
Erweiterungen - Infos zur artgerechten Haltung / phpBB Ext Check - Analyse von Erweiterungen bezüglich Vorgaben und Kompatibilität